タグ

2013年11月15日のブックマーク (4件)

  • nothingcosmos wiki

    2016/05/04 LLVMのビルド方法 2014/04/08 OpenJDKのビルド方法 2014/02/23 作成したスライド 2014/02/22 JVM(HotSpot) VS. Dart VM 2014/02/16 RevisionLog32000台 DartVMのリビジョンログ 2014/01/11 RevisionLog31000台 2013/12/23 RevisionLog30000台 LLVMとの連携方法 2013/12/09 LLVMに関して LLVMのデバッグ方法 SSA形式 2013/11/10 RevisionLog29000台 2013/10/21 JITコンパイラ メニュー 自動並列化 ベクトル化 GCCに関して 2013/10/20 RevisionLog28000台 2013/09/28 RevisionLog27000台

    embedded
    embedded 2013/11/15
    いまどきのコンパイラの情報が豊富。
  • ART Vs Dalvik in Android 4.4 - How much faster is it?

    embedded
    embedded 2013/11/15
    ART vs Dalvik比較動画。
  • Linuxに勝てなかったPlan 9 - @IT

    2002年頃、とある雑誌でPlan 9の記事を6ページほど作ったことがある。冷静に考えると、とても流行するようには思えなかったのだが、私にはPlan 9はまぶしく輝いて見えた。それは紛れもなく未来のUNIXだったし、日々コンピュータやネットワークを利用する環境として、ぜひとも使いたいと思えるような機能が多くあった。 「Plan 9」(プラン・ナイン)はUNIXが生まれたベル研究所で、次世代UNIXとして開発されていた分散OSだ。UNIXやC言語を生み出したケン・トンプソン、デニス・リッチー、ロブ・パイクらのチームが、当時UNIXが抱えていた限界を打ち破るために、ネットワークやGUIを最初からUNIXの設計思想に基づいて取り入れた先進的なOSだった。それは、未来のUNIXとなるはずだった。 UNIXの大きな特徴として、デバイスをファイルにマッピングして抽象化するというものがある。各I/Oポー

    embedded
    embedded 2013/11/15
    深い話。
  • DalvikVMに替わるランタイム ART - Happy My Life

    Android 4.4 KitKat 冬コミ原稿リレーの 11月15日分です。 ここではKitKat(Android 4.4)から追加された新しいAndroidランタイムであるART(Android RunTimeの意味?)の話をします(ランタイムとはソフトウェアを動作させる基盤となるライブラリのこと)これまで利用されていたDalvikVMにかわるランタイムとして2年間かけて開発されてきたようです。 ARTの最大の特徴は、ソフトウェアをネイティブコード(CPUが直接実行できるコード)で実行することを前提に設計されている点です。 ARTを有効化することで、アプリケーションはAOTコンパイラによって事前にネイティブコード化され、実行時にはネイティブコード化されたアプリケーションを実行しています。そのためパフォーマンスが向上が期待できます。 ARTはKitKatで初めて公開されたコードであり開発

    DalvikVMに替わるランタイム ART - Happy My Life
    embedded
    embedded 2013/11/15
    アプリ開発者向けのARTの記事。